Thomas Harte
|
ea81096a43
|
Reinstall debugging temporariness.
|
2025-02-07 18:09:33 -05:00 |
|
Thomas Harte
|
07493a6b18
|
Remove need for a CRC generator instance.
|
2025-02-04 22:54:39 -05:00 |
|
Thomas Harte
|
ca7c1bc631
|
Remove redundant inlines.
|
2025-02-04 00:00:12 -05:00 |
|
Thomas Harte
|
259070c658
|
Unify reverse functions.
|
2025-02-03 23:58:41 -05:00 |
|
Thomas Harte
|
e1a7dd9b24
|
Implement recursive reverse.
|
2025-02-03 23:50:15 -05:00 |
|
Thomas Harte
|
53a3e88d16
|
Shunt CRC XOR table generation to compile time.
|
2025-01-28 17:36:32 -05:00 |
|
Thomas Harte
|
ce5aae3f7d
|
Adjust more dangling indentation changes.
|
2024-12-04 22:29:08 -05:00 |
|
Thomas Harte
|
a3d37640aa
|
Switch include guards to #pragma once.
|
2024-01-16 23:34:46 -05:00 |
|
Thomas Harte
|
f190a1395a
|
Enables detection of CPC-format tape data.
It turns out that the Spectrum's timings are its alone; speed autodetection added.
|
2021-03-10 22:02:10 -05:00 |
|
Thomas Harte
|
512a52e88d
|
Increases const correctness, marks some additional constructors as constexpr, switches std::atomic construction style.
|
2020-05-20 23:34:26 -04:00 |
|
Thomas Harte
|
4b53f6a9f0
|
Renames T to the more-communicative IntType, adds some explicit constexpra.
|
2020-01-27 08:28:20 -05:00 |
|
Thomas Harte
|
561e149058
|
Better templates the CRC generator.
|
2020-01-27 00:03:01 -05:00 |
|
Thomas Harte
|
1b4b6b0aee
|
Renames: NumberTheory -> Numeric.
|
2020-01-19 23:14:35 -05:00 |
|